Tax-deductibility for donors
Donations may be tax-deductible for residents of Latvia under local rules. Confirm with the charity directly.
Dava partiku labdaribas fonds is in Latvia (EU/EEA). Dutch donors may be eligible for deductibility if the charity is recognized under the Dutch ANBI cross-EU equivalence rules. Check the Belastingdienst ANBI register or consult a Dutch tax advisor.
Dava partiku labdaribas fonds is registered in Latvia. US donors generally cannot deduct gifts to non-US charities directly. To claim a deduction, route the gift through a US 'Friends of' fiscal sponsor or a donor-advised fund that performs equivalency determination (IRS Rev. Proc. 92-94).
Always confirm tax treatment with the charity directly or your tax advisor before donating.
